Features:
Previously so called “data-loggers” have been required to do additional tasks such multiplexing and A/D conversion. To reduce the cost/instrument of this technology, designers enable several instruments to be logged at a single data-logger, adding still further to the complexity, size and cost of the device. With complexity comes the requirement for configuration (both hardwire and software) and associated training. The result is an expensive, complex and bulky solution completely unsuited to mining deployment. SLUG changes the Rules All that changes with the SLUG. This is possible because all YieldPoint sensors transmit digital signals that require the minimum processing prior to writing into FLASH memory. Due to it’s simple design, incredibly small size and very low cost, each SLUG is dedicated to a single instrument. With this comes complete versatility, flexibility and simplicity: if a specific sensor needs to be monitored, SLUG can be deployed in a few seconds. No configuration is required since YieldPoint’s digital sensors inform SLUG of critical information such as their SensorID, SensorType and the number of channels - just ‘plug & SLUG’. Also, by minimizing the cost of a individual data-logger, high risk deployment close to blasts is viable and lead-wire (the most vulnerable part of any sensor) length can be minimized. If the SLUG is destroyed during deployment, the replacement will cost probably less than 10% of a typical datalogger.

75% of the SLUG’s space requirement consists of a 9V battery. By putting the SLUG into SLEEP mode between measurements the battery can last up to 3 mos. Even then if battery power is lost the data stored in slug will be retained. 512kb of memory will allow an instrument with up to 10 channels to be monitored 3 times/day up to 3 mos. When the SLUG’s memory is full is can be configured to overwrite beginning at the first memory address or just stop logging. Data from the SLUG is output into CSV text files. These can easily be imported into Microsoft Excel or any database package, and is fully compatible with YieldPoint's MineScope database. Advantages:
Specifications: Dimensions: 56mm x 56mm x 30mm Battery: 9V Memory: 256kb FLASH memory 12,000 16bit samples samples, 512kb optional. Storage: 16 bit resolution Frequency: 5 min, 10 min, 1/hr, 3 rdgs/day, 1 rdg/day Duration: 3mos (3 rdg/day), Alkaline battery.
